We demonstrated that, in contrast to classical opioid receptors, ACKR3 would not bring about classical G protein signaling and isn't modulated because of the classical prescription or analgesic opioids, such as morphine, fentanyl, or buprenorphine, or by nonselective opioid antagonists such as naloxone. Instead, we proven that LIH383, an ACKR3-selective subnanomolar competitor peptide, helps prevent ACKR3’s unfavorable regulatory perform on opioid peptides within an ex vivo rat Mind design and potentiates their exercise in direction of classical opioid receptors.

Network activity profiles evoked by conolidine and cannabidiol carefully matched that of ω-conotoxin CVIE, a powerful and selective Cav2.2 calcium channel blocker with proposed antinociceptive action suggesting which they way too would block this channel. To validate this, Cav2.2 channels ended up heterologously expressed, recorded with total-mobile patch clamp and conolidine/cannabidiol was used. Remarkably, conolidine and cannabidiol both inhibited Cav2.two, offering a glimpse to the MOA that can underlie their antinociceptive motion. These facts emphasize the utility of cultured neuronal community-primarily based Proleviate workflows to effectively establish MOA of drugs inside of a really scalable assay.
